The best way to save funds is to book at a site which offers a low price guarantee. This means that prior to your trip if you find a lower price the site will match the price or refund your money so you can book the lower rate. Most hotel chains do not offer this element because they really sell their rooms at wholesale to suppliers and as a result would always be undercut.

Booking in advance is the best way to save funds because as the hotel gets more reservations they will boost prices. You need to settle on when you are going to go and then get your trip booked, you can make changes soon after on most reservations, but you will be subject to the higher rates since it is closer to the time of your trip.
